Systems and processes were in place to protect people from the risk of abuse. Staff had received training and understood how to report concerns. Risks to people were managed with electronic care plans. Medicines were managed safely with complete records matching stock
There was a friendly, open, positive, and supportive culture at Peel House Nursing Home. Staff comments were: 'Communication is good, management support is good, and I feel the home is well-led', 'Everyone here is so welcoming... the whole culture here is very caring'
There were enough staff on duty to meet people's needs. People told us, 'There is not a high turnover of staff' and, 'They have enough staff, and they know my name'
Feedback from a visiting health and social care professional highlighted, 'We have seen massive changes and they have worked with us to ensure improvements are in place, we have supported with care planning training, pressure ulcer prevention training and management of contractures.' Staff told us they received regular supervision
Staff told us the registered manager was always present and approachable. Staff comments were: 'Yes, I feel supported here it's getting better and better, the home has totally changed since [registered manager's name] came. It is well organised and looks totally different so many things have been improved'
Per 2019 comprehensive inspection: An activity programme was in place including reminiscence, exercise and choir practice provided by activity coordinators who demonstrated skill and passion, plus one-to-one activities and links with local school for intergenerational interaction
